Physical Address
304 North Cardinal St.
Dorchester Center, MA 02124
Physical Address
304 North Cardinal St.
Dorchester Center, MA 02124
Original version Of This is the story Present How many magazinesThe
Break a question to a magic 8 ball and it will answer yes, no, or annoyingly something involuntary. We think of it as a kid’s toy, but theoretical computer scientists use a similar tool. They often imagine that they can consult a hypothetical device called Oracles that can answer immediately and correctly specific questions. These fabulous thought tests have inspired the new algorithm and helped researchers’ count on the landscape map.
Researchers who call Oracles work in a subfield in computer science, known as the Computational Complexity Theory. They are concerned with the underlying difficulty of having a number of a number or the shortest way between two points on a network. Some problems are easy to solve, others seem to be stronger but there are solutions that are easy to test, easy for others Quantum computer However, it is seemingly difficult for the general public.
Complexity theorists want to understand whether these apparent differences of disadvantages are basic. What is intrinsic about some problems is tough, or are we not cunning enough to come up with a good solution? Researchers addressed these questions by picking up problems ”Complexity class“-All of the simple problems go into one class, for example, and easily all the problems of the check moves to the other-and proves the theorem about the relationship between that class.
Unfortunately, mapping the disadvantage of calculation has become good, difficult. So in the middle of the 1970s, some researchers began to study what would happen if the rules were different. That’s where the Oracles come.
Like Magic 8 balls, Oracles are devices that answer yes or a question immediately without expressing anything about their internal work. Unlike Magic 8 balls, they always say yes or no and they are always correct – the advantage of being imaginary. Furthermore, any given Oracle will only answer a particular kind of question, such as “Is this number the main?”
What makes these imaginary devices useful for real world understanding? In short, they can reveal hidden connections in the class of various complications.
Take two famous complexity classes. There are classes of problems that are easy to solve, which researchers say “P” and the problems that are easy to test, which researchers call “NP”. Is it easy to solve all the simple problems of all checks? If that is the meaning of it will be equal to NPP and all encryption will be Is easy to crack (Between other consequences). The complication theorists suspect that NPP does not equal, but they cannot prove it, though they are trying to pin the relationship between two classes More than 50 yearsThe
Oracles helped them understand better what they were doing with them. Researchers have discovered Oracles that answer questions that help solve many different problems. In a world where there was a hotline of an oracle in each computer, all easily Czech-Chec problems will be easy to solve and the PNP will be equal. However, the other, the less aided oracles have the opposite effect. In a world that is populated by these oracles, P and NPs will probably be different.